Jane Adams discovered that mothers who worked all day had no way to care for their children. So they would tie their young children to a table leg and leave them in the tenement while they went off to work. These mothers were immigrants so they knew little to no English and they worked in factories which paid very little and had poor working conditions.
Her findings were successful because she founded the Hull House. A settlement house in Chicago for immigrants and the poor. She put in a child day care so children could be left there and the Hull House helped European immigrants to get a better life.
